Nitrogen fertilizers – Manufacturing process of Nitrogen ...

Another important nitrogen-based fertilizer is the urea, which is produced by a reaction of ammonia with carbon dioxide at high pressure. Both ammonium nitrate and urea can be further concentrated and converted into a solid form (prills or granules).

25-01-2021· Coal ash includes a number of by-products produced from burning coal, including: Fly Ash, a very fine, powdery material composed mostly of silica made from the burning of finely ground coal in a boiler. Bottom Ash, a coarse, angular ash particle that is too large to be carried up into the smoke stacks so it forms in the bottom of the coal furnace.

Successful use of stainless steels in nitrogen‐based ...

17-06-2004· In ammonia plants duplex stainless steels have been successfully used in many heat exchangers operating up to 600°C in cooling water polluted by chlorides. The duplex stainless steels offer a safe and cost-effiecient alternative to carbon steel and stainless steels in the 300 series. In urea plants operating with stripper technology the material ...

Turning coal into fertilizer - Green Living Tips

08-08-2009· Perdaman Chemicals and Fertilisers is developing a US$2.5 billion nitrogen fertiliser manufacturing plant at Collie, Western Australia, transforming sub-bituminous coal into urea. The company says the coal gasification process used in the production of urea from the Collie Urea plant will produce lower emissions than a coal fired power plant of an equivalent size.
